A new question, directed for staff on a contest's awarding scheme.

Say this competition is administered in 3 rounds. Although each round is contained separately from each other as if it were 3 mini-contests. Each contestant can participate in one, two, or all three mini-contests. Contestants register to participate in a particular medium by making a post announcing what medium they wish to partake in.

Here's a timeline example of how long the medium type will be allowed to be worked on. All contestants register on the Days 1 to 8 of the competition's existence. Then after registration is over, contestants work on their creation(s). The timeline is overlapped so that on Days 9 to 16, three types of medium are being worked on. Days 17 to 24, two types of medium are being worked on. Days 25 to 32, only the video-based medium is worked on. Then after each portion of the competition is over, judging and voting commences. Scores are then released after the judging and voting are tabulated:



So let's see the image-based ad. Contestants who participate in the image round have 8 days to compose a creation of some sort. After 8 days are over, the image round closes. The judges examine the images, and can take up to 8 days to judge. There is also voting by the forum members on which ads they like.

After the scores and votes are tallied, the top scorer of the image based round wins that portion of the contest, and staff gives a 1st prize ribbon to that contestant for winning that part of the competition.

The same type of awarding would occur with the top scorer of the audio-based portion of the competition, and another 1st place award is given for the video-based portion as well.

Basically, if this ad-creation competition last for 3 "rounds", there can be three winners, and three ribbons awarded (one for each winner of the image-based, audio-based, and video-based rounds).

Is staff opened to awarding three 1st place ribbons in such a scenario?
